Output 61ec57bf2bb5dee6bae88f6e4e4ae1239fbdbe8c9df70a9c4e41abb5bbb4ab4e:1

value
8440087
script pubkey
OP_0 OP_PUSHBYTES_20 16ae3bf4c68295c22dd2d7c0d1ea8a0d231fc7f8
address
bc1qz6hrhaxxs22uytwj6lqdr652p533l3lcefs9fg
transaction
61ec57bf2bb5dee6bae88f6e4e4ae1239fbdbe8c9df70a9c4e41abb5bbb4ab4e
confirmations
158111
spent
true